Opening Timming:

The Arpora Handmade Bazaar in Goa is open on Fridays, Saturdays and Sundays from 5 pm to 10 pm. You must visit one of the famous Markets in Goa.

What to Buy:

• Coconut Shell Craft: From chimes to coasters and more, Goan artisans skillfully design a variety of handmade items from coconut shells. • Wooden Crafts: This bazaar offers an array of wooden artifacts like key Chains, jewelry boxes, coasters, and so much more! • Sea Shell Art: Colorful and intricate patterns made from sea shells put together to make various items like dream-catchers, wall hangings, necklaces, and jewelry. • Beaded Jewelry: Elegant handmade necklaces, earrings, and bangles, strung using colorful threads and beads. • Cotton Embroidery: Artisans put craftsmanship and passion into every thread, creating hand embroidered fabrics, cushion covers and more. • Goan Pottery: Traditional design ceramic pots, lamps and wall hangings that portray Goan culture and tradition. Famous For:

The Arpora Handmade Bazaar is located in the scenic town of Arpora, Goa. Spanning over 16 acres, it is the biggest handmade market in India and is a must-visit for shopaholics and art lovers. With over 500 vendors, the Arpora Handmade Bazaar features some of the most unique handmade products ranging from rustic furniture to exquisite artwork and handcrafted souvenirs. How to reach:

The Arpora Handmade Bazaar is located close to the Anjuna, Baga and Vagator beaches, in Arpora village. It is easily accessible by road from most popular locations in Goa. The easiest way to reach Arpora is to take a taxi from the nearest major city or airport. You can also take a bus from Panjim, Margao, Ponda, Mapusa, Calangute or Anjuna which will drop you off at the Arpora Handmade Bazaar.
